Job description

The Management Accountant is responsible for the management and continuous improvement of Management Reporting, Budgeting processes and BI solution of the Group.
 
Key relationships:

  • Executive Committee – Preparing the consolidated EMT Reports.
  • General Managers – Working alongside and supporting the Executives in maximising the company’s performance.
  • Head of Finance – Providing advice and support with managing the company’s finance related risks.
  • FP&A Team – Providing leadership and technical advice to the team.
  • Auditors – Working with financial auditors to complete audits in a timely manner.
  • Suppliers and Advisors ­– Managing relevant supplier relationships to obtain best value for money and appropriate service delivery.

Key Responsibilities:-
 
Reporting:

  • Prepare the monthly EMT Report, and any other papers as required
  • Prepare Finance reports, including insightful analysis of financial performance, cash, debtors, securities and job costing
  • Provide monthly budget versus actual reporting and full year forecasts


Decision Support:

  • Provide timely, accurate and relevant financial information to business unit commercial managers and general managers


Budgets:

  • Prepare annual budgets for the business
  • Prepare/refresh the Finance business plan


Recharges and Rate Card

  • Develop and set project recharge and rate cards


Financial Analysis:

  • Provide inputs for financial models used for feasibility assessments


Overheads

  • Management and reporting of Group overheads


Systems:

  • Establish themselves as the BI “Champion”
  • Drive the development of the BI tool
  • Establish and maintain suitable finance and reporting systems
  • Further develop and utilise the BI application and any management information systems


Tender Support

  • Manage requests for financial and project data required in support of EOI’s, Tenders etc
